About Appeal Law in Mexico City, Mexico

The legal field of appeal in Mexico City pertain to situations where a judgement from a lower court is brought to a higher court for review. These are typically occasions where the party, either defendant or claimant, perceive a misjudgement or improperly conducted trial. Falling under Mexico's Federal Code of Civil Procedures, appeals can be complex and require deep understanding of law and justice procedures, hence may necessitate the guidance of a legal expert.

Local Laws Overview

In Mexico City, the Federal Code of Civil Procedures governs the procedures for appeal. Key factors include that the appeal must be based on perceived procedural, factual or legal errors during the original trial. It's not simply a chance for re-trial. Additionally, the time limit for filing an appeal is ten days from when the judgement is declared. It is also worth noting that the right to appeal certain judgements may be waivered in the initial trial agreement.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I appeal any decision?

Generally, you can appeal decisions if you believe there were errors of law made, but not all decisions can be appealed. Best to consult with an appeal attorney to understand your legal options.

What is the time frame for filing an appeal?

In general, the appellant has ten days from the judgement declaring date to file an appeal, subject to certain exceptions.

Do I need a different lawyer for an appeal?

While you can use the same attorney, it is often advised to work with a lawyer who specializes in appeals owing to the different expertise and deep understanding of court systems required.

Can new evidence be presented in an appeal?

Typically, an appeal focuses on possible mistakes made during the initial trial and not on new evidence. Presenting new evidence in an appeal is generally not permitted.

What happens if I win the appeal?

If successful, the appeal court may reverse the lower court's decision or may remand it, meaning it will send the case back to the lower court for a new trial.
